48 Sedgley Avenue is a two-bedroom end-of-terrace house in Nottingham (NG2 4HZ). It has a recorded floor area of 78 m² (around 840 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1900-1929 and council tax band A. The latest certificate (August 2017) shows a D (score 61), on the cusp of jumping into the C band. The recommended improvements would lift it to B (score 88), a 2-band jump.
Sale prices here have outpaced England HPI: 8.3% per year against 0% for the wider region.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£223/sq ft) was about 141.1% above the typical sold price in the postcode. Sold August 2024 for £187,000. Across the public record there are 4 sales, relatively high churn for a single property.
